This tournament will pay approximately twelve percent (12%) of the total entries. All Day 1 flights will continue until ten percent (10%) of their starting players remain. Day 2 resumes 10/17 at Noon.

Other Info

General Notes
The bounty prize pool will be consisted of $160 from each tournament entry. For the purpose of these rules, bounty prizes will be separated into two (2) groups, herein referred to as “Day 1” and “Day 2”. Day 1 bounty prizes will be awarded for participants eliminated on sessions starting on Thursday, October 14, 2021, Friday October 15, 2021, and Saturday October 16, 2021. Day 2 bounty prizes will be awarded for participants eliminated on the session starting on Sunday October 17, 2021. The bounty prizes for Day 1 shall be worth fifty dollars ($50) each, except for the sponsored “Boone’s Bounties”, which shall be worth five hundred dollars ($500) each. These bounty prizes shall be awarded for all eliminations that occur during a participant’s starting flight. The bounty prizes for Day 2 shall be worth anywhere from one hundred dollars ($100) to twenty-five thousand dollars ($25,000). These bounty prizes shall be awarded only to those participants advancing to the final day of play for this event.
